This book of New Mexico trivia presented in question-and-answer format is designed to appeal to the curious newcomer as well as to the expert native who wants to show off to friends, family, and coworkers. Some of the questions are easy enough for tourists to answer: "What are farolitos?"

Some require a long-standing familiarity with New Mexico's history, geography, and culture: "What is the best translation of the name Albuquerque?" "What is the most common place-name in New Mexico?" Some of the questions are next to impossible: "What was the population of Albuquerque in 1706?"
